Animal testing, also known as animal experimentation, animal research, and in vivo testing, is the use of non-human animals in experiments (although some research about animals involves exactly natural behaviors or pure observation, such as a mouse running a maze or field studies of chimp troops). The research is conducted within universities, medical schools, pharmaceutical companies, farms, defense establishments, and commercial facilities that provide animal-testing services to industry. 1 It includes pure research (such as genetics, developmental biology, and behavioral studies) as well as apply research (such as biomedical research, xenotransplantation, drug testing, and toxicology tests, including cosmetics testing). Animals atomic number 18 also used for education, breeding, and defense research.The practice is regulated to various de grees in different countries.
